The Art of Generalism: Navigating Across Disciplines
In an increasingly specialized world, the role of the generalist emerges as a beacon of versatility and adaptability. Generalists are individuals whose knowledge spans multiple disciplines, allowing them to connect disparate ideas, solve multifaceted problems, and foster innovation through an eclectic accumulation of experiences. This article delves into the essence of generalism, its significance in various fields, and how it cultivates a dynamic approach to contemporary challenges.
The Breadth of Knowledge

At the very core of generalism lies the intention to acquire breadth rather than mere depth of knowledge. This approach starkly contrasts with that of specialists, who typically dive deeply into one specific area. While specialization undoubtedly yields expertise, generalists bring a unique perspective to the table. They can synthesize information across various domains, enabling them to deduce insights that may elude specialists operating within confined paradigms.
Consider, for instance, the burgeoning field of innovation management. Companies increasingly seek professionals who can navigate the complex interplay between technology, market demands, design, and strategic implementation. A generalist in this space would be well-equipped to understand the nuances of consumer behavior, the intricacies of technical development, and the rhythms of organizational change. This fusion of knowledge fosters a holistic view that is indispensable in today’s fast-paced ecosystems.

Adapting to Change
Change is the only constant in our contemporary milieu, and generalists embody the spirit of adaptability. Amid economic fluctuations, technological disruptions, and shifting cultural landscapes, those who can pivot and reassess their strategies are destined for success. Generalists are inherently predisposed to embrace change, for they are used to drawing on a rich tapestry of experiences and knowledge.
In the realm of technology, the rapid evolution of digital tools mandates a workforce that can swiftly learn and adopt new skills. Generalists possess an innate ability to transition between different technical platforms, programming languages, and management methodologies, thereby fostering innovation and resilience. Their diverse skill set equips them to harness the potential of various tools, ensuring organizations do not merely keep pace with change but thrive amid it.
